    Hotel was very nice. Beautiful both inside and out. Only had a few interactions w/ the staff, but they were all very helpful. The rooms are very nice except the bathrooms are very small. That is the only downside. The hotel is in a great location. We were able to walk to everything we did in downtown. Use the parking garage instead of the valet b/c its right behind the hotel, so its very convenient especially since you don't need to drive. Outside courtyard is beautiful and night time. If you don't mind spending a few dollars for dinner, goto 82 Queen right next to the hotel, it has the best food.

    My wife and I stayed at this hotel for two nights in September 2009. I would highly recommend staying here. Although somewhat expensive, you get what you pay for. The staff and all employees were courteous and helpful, and we felt like we were pampered guests. Everything about the room was clean and very comfortable. Room temperature was comfortable, and no outside noise to keep us awake. Beautiful lobby and courtyard, ideal for sitting outside and enjoying a glass of wine which we did both nights. The location was ideal with regard to the historic district. The only negative was that we had the choice of paying for valet service or parking our car ourselves. would probably park our car ourselves in the parking ramp next time. The valet attendants were extremely nice, and allowed us to park our car at no charge in front of the hotel in the valet parking area for two hours the day we checked out, so that we could take a carriage ride before leaving town.

    I stayed for 4 nights with my 16 year old son at The Mills House as we dropped his brother off at C of C. The staff was professional and their cheerful dispositions were contagious. Our room was very spacious and clean. The valet service was perfect for us. But if we weren’t transporting dorm items we wouldn’t have even used the car as the MH hotel was a nice walk to everything we wanted to see. We were shocked, when he left $ cash by mistake on the desk and it was still there when we returned 5 hours later after the room had been cleaned.16 year old loved the pool which was never too crowded even on the hottest days of August. During our stay the kitchen was closed for renovations but the staff was eager to recommend many delicious places for us to try.

    The Mills House is in a wonderful location, close to the historic homes and fab restaurants, as well as great shopping including Saks and specialty boutiques. The rooms, as to be expected in an older property, were small. The bathrooms are tiny however. This was a problem for us as we like to primp. Also, there was no mini bar in the room-they will bring a small refrigerator to your room at no charge. They do provide a nice coffee maker and robes. The staff was very helpful and courteous. The dining room and bar were charming and served good food and drinks but both were a little pricey.

    Have stayed at the Mills House a number of times and always enjoy it. Room amenities are fine, but far from ""luxury"" - the draw of the Mills House is its location and things to do near the hotel, not in the hotel itself. The front desk assigned us a room that was already occupied by an older couple who had been moved from another room because of their complaints about the noise. Other than that hiccup, the check-in, check out was quick and easy. We didn't have the same issues with noise, probably because we had stayed there before and expect a historic, older hotel in the middle of downtown to have some noise on a busy summer weekend. It is difficult to beat the combination of value and location of this hotel in Charleston.
